This year, instead of leading an Impact Zambia Mission trip, I return to Africa on a more personal journey—one rooted in reflection, celebration, and connection. I’ve recently marked several personal and professional milestones, and this trip becomes a timely pause to discern what the future may hold. Being back home, walking familiar paths, and reconnecting with the people, wildlife, and landscapes that shape me offers a deep sense of grounding. I have the joy of showing friends “my Africa”—not just its beauty and wildlife, but its warmth, resilience, and spirit.
This isn’t just a visit; it’s a journey inward, a moment to realign with purpose. Amidst the celebrations, I find myself drawn again to the dreams that inspire the Impact Life Training Centre. Seeing Africa through new eyes reignites that vision. My hope is that, through this personal window into my home, you too will be moved—not only by its vibrant culture and breathtaking landscapes, but also by the incredible potential we have to invest in its future.
Your support of the Impact Life Training Centre helps raise up young leaders who will carry Zambia and Africa forward. This is more than my story—it’s an open invitation to be part of something lasting.
